Orken Zhumazhanovich Mamyrbayev  in the Almaty region, is an Associate Professor and Ph.D. in Information Systems. He graduated from Abay Kazakh National Pedagogical University in 2001 with a degree in Computer Science. With over 18 years of experience in scientific and pedagogical work, he currently serves as Deputy Director for Science at the Institute of Information and Computational Technologies under the Ministry of Education and Science of Kazakhstan. He is a specialist in speech recognition, digital signal processing, and natural language processing, and has supervised numerous Ph.D. and master’s theses. Mamyrbayev has authored over 100 scientific papers, holds 2 patents, and has completed advanced training in several countries, including Japan, Azerbaijan, and Malaysia. He is an active member of various scientific councils and an academician of the International Academy of Informatization.

Prof. Dr. Zhong Su is a distinguished professor and the Dean of the Academic Committee at Beijing Information Science & Technology University, where he also directs the Beijing Key Laboratory of High Dynamic Navigation Technology. With a robust academic foundation from Beijing Institute of Technology, including a Bachelor’s in Automatic Control, a Master’s in Computer Control, and a Ph.D. in Physical Electronics and Photoelectronics, Prof. Su specializes in autonomous positioning and control for intelligent autonomous systems and robotics. His prolific career includes leading over 40 projects, securing 58 invention patents, and publishing over 110 high-level papers. Recognized with accolades such as National Excellent Teacher and Beijing Scholar, Prof. Su’s work has significantly advanced the fields of image recognition and deep learning, impacting both national and international research landscapes.

Dr. Brijesh Kumar Chaurasia is a distinguished academic and researcher specializing in network security, with a primary focus on Vehicular Ad hoc Networks, Trust Management in VANETs, Blockchain, cloud authentication, and IoV/IoT. He earned his Ph.D. in Privacy Preservation in Vehicular Ad-hoc Networks from IIIT-Allahabad in 2013 and his M. Tech in Computer Science and Engineering from DAVV-Indore in 2006. With over 22 years of teaching experience and 4+ years in research and development, Dr. Chaurasia currently serves as a Professor and Dean of Research and Innovation at Pranveer Singh Institute of Technology, Kanpur. He has previously taught at ITM Group in Gwalior and IIIT Lucknow. He has been a principal investigator on several research grants, supervised numerous Ph.D. and postgraduate theses, and holds patents in IoT and smart systems. Dr. Chaurasia is actively involved in professional activities as a Senior Member of IEEE, Fellow of IETE, and member of IE and CSI. He has contributed to international journals and participated in various FDPs and workshops, showcasing his commitment to advancing knowledge and innovation in his field.
